Why Use Wall-Mounted Fans for Vertical Plant Walls?

Vertical plant walls require consistent airflow to prevent issues such as mold, mildew, and stagnant air pockets that can harm plant health. Proper ventilation ensures:

  • Even distribution of humidity: This prevents water from settling unevenly, reducing the risk of fungal infections.
  • Temperature regulation: Fans help dissipate heat generated by grow lights or sunlight.
  • Improved gas exchange: Air movement facilitates the uptake of carbon dioxide by plants, which is essential for photosynthesis.
  • Pest deterrence: Air circulation can minimize pest infestations by creating an unfavorable environment.

Wall-mounted fans are particularly advantageous because they save floor space and can be positioned optimally to direct airflow across the entire surface of the vertical garden.

Key Features to Consider When Choosing a Wall-Mounted Fan

Selecting the appropriate fan is crucial for maximizing plant health while ensuring energy efficiency and minimal noise disturbance. Here are some important features to consider:

1. Airflow Capacity

Meas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), airflow capacity determines how much air the fan can move. For vertical plant walls, choose a fan with sufficient CFM to cover the entire wall surface without creating excessive wind that might damage delicate leaves.

2. Adjustable Speed Settings

Variable speeds allow you to customize airflow based on seasonal changes or specific plant needs. Gentle breezes are ideal for seedlings or sensitive species, while stronger airflow can help during hotter months or for more robust plants.

3. Oscillation

Fans with oscillation can sweep air across a wider area, ensuring even coverage. This feature reduces stagnant spots and promotes uniform growth across your vertical garden.

4. Energy Efficiency

Since fans may run for extended periods, energy-efficient models help reduce electricity costs while maintaining performance.

5. Noise Level

Especially important in residential or office settings, quieter fans prevent disturbances while still providing effective airflow.

6. Durability and Weather Resistance

If your vertical plant wall is outdoors or in a semi-exposed area, choose fans made with weather-resistant materials that can withstand humidity and occasional splashes of water.

7. Mounting Flexibility

Look for fans with adjustable mounting brackets that allow you to tilt or swivel the unit for optimal positioning.

Tips for Optimizing Fan Use with Vertical Plant Walls

To get the most out of your wall-mounted fan while protecting your plants:

  1. Position Fans Strategically: Place fans so that air flows uniformly across all sections of your green wall.
  2. Avoid Direct Blasts: Aim fans slightly away from delicate foliage to prevent physical damage.
  3. Combine With Humidity Control: Use dehumidifiers or humidifiers alongside fans depending on your climate.
  4. Monitor Plant Responses: Adjust speed and duration based on how your plants react—wilting leaves may signal excessive wind.
  5. Regular Maintenance: Clean fan blades and grills periodically to avoid dust accumulation affecting performance or introducing pathogens.
